Age | Commit message (Collapse) | Author | Files | Lines |
|
Ticket: CSIT-1541
Ticket: VPP-1722
Ticket: CSIT-1546
+ Increase timeout to hide x520 slownes of show hardware detail.
- Install sshpass and update ssh client in virl bootstrap.
+ Added TODOs to remove when CSIT-1546 is fixed.
+ Enable default socksvr on any startup conf.
+ Improve OptionString init and repr.
- The non-socket executor still kept for stats.
+ Remove everything unrelated to stats from non-socket executor.
- Remove some debug-loooking calls to avoid failures.
TODO: Introduce proper parsing to the affected keywords.
+ Reduce logging from PAPI code to level INFO.
- Needs https://gerrit.fd.io/r/20660 to fully work.
+ Change default values for LocalExecution.run()
+ Return code check enabled by default.
Code is more readable when rc!=0 is allowed explicitly,
and the test code will now detect unexpected failures.
+ Logging disabled by default.
Output XML is large already. Important logging can be enabled explicitly.
+ Restore alphabetical order in common.sh functions.
Change-Id: I05882cb6b620ad14638f7404b5ad38c7a5de9e6c
Signed-off-by: Vratko Polak <vrpolak@cisco.com>
|
|
Change-Id: I34bdc17d6350e5a441dabd9154620627780f4c12
Signed-off-by: Tibor Frank <tifrank@cisco.com>
|
|
Change-Id: I7758d888f1a5edc42cba3c6131b8c882e709dc91
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: I0062710d58996be767a852dc00545fedd60a5c72
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: Icc703c7055047b81a8281776c78752f145d9d004
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: I9148f6de75c3100f827eedec48c4c0ccb343bc54
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
CSIT-1371
Map commands were remove from VAT by patch https://gerrit.fd.io/r/#/c/16115/.
Excluding softwire functional tests from execution until corresponding csit KWs are fixed.
Change-Id: I2adc580fb4770746c355f12f5ce7e7f8823255d8
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
This package is not needed for csit enymore.
Change-Id: Ie32a9c9322873e66554bb69112d4428697c866db
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: I8aae4cb85f9bb1efaa19d75e2fd7c9593f20756d
Signed-off-by: Peter Mikus <pmikus@cisco.com>
(cherry picked from commit e44edcedef4dd2fee1c21b122b4bc6bb8586598e)
|
|
Change-Id: Ib4e72dc8e3c0fedfcd702f4f97bc4f26cbc642e9
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Download specific version of VPP/DKMS via download script.
Change-Id: I6585790224d746a9edea7fa6624e810f389218e6
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Move VPP installation to separate test in test suite setup phase
to clearly indicate any issue with VPP installation.
Added test to check VPP responsiveness after installation.
Change-Id: Idc2c78152e23aa7301bb5dbf9b1b6f4b639c3e84
Signed-off-by: Andrej Kilvady <andrej.kilvady@pantheon.tech>
|
|
- Fix the path of temporary result files to workspace instead of
/run/shm
Change-Id: I4819ef5d6371412a91b6736aa36b223df38eacac
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Change-Id: I6fb16e799e991ce01e9f997a05c4be72a26ce3af
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Change-Id: Icd149927c6b2893f8f716df29d8de475e809be49
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Change-Id: Ia64bfdbcc1ea5218a7b3b6708ad75662129a46cc
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: I8441d58a2d7f604b64fff358a3cef8d72289dcdc
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use new vpp ref build - ubuntu 16.04:
18.01-rc0~156-gae5a02f~b3093_amd64
- use new vpp ref build - centos7:
18.01-rc0~156_gae5a02f~b3090.x86_64
- use new dpdk version:
17.08-vpp2
- builds tested by semiweekly jobs:
https://jenkins.fd.io/view/csit/job/csit-vpp-verify-master-ubuntu1604-semiweekly/85/
https://jenkins.fd.io/view/csit/job/csit-vpp-verify-master-centos7-semiweekly/85/
- remove vpp-debuginfo centos7 artifact as not provided for new versions
Change-Id: I18445feac98304e7e7ecdf77968acebf2d5aef09
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Remove downloading if DPDK package from Nexus if
the job is vpp-csit*.
Change-Id: I37aada67c4334433618e122676fd1f50591b6742
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Change-Id: I772c9e214be2461adf58124998d272e7d795220f
Signed-off-by: Tibor Frank <tifrank@cisco.com>
Signed-off-by: Maciek Konstantynowicz <mkonstan@cisco.com>
|
|
- use SIM limit per VIRL server instead of VM limit per VIRL
Change-Id: I8b6688e3c37fd26f294a84f8435447302aad6e5b
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Optimize VIRL job scheduling algorithm based on available VIRL
host capacity. Add IP pool availability pre-checks.
- add quota based on max. allowe IPs and max. allowe VMs per virl
- use one common bootstrap file instead of two separate files (one
for ubutnut, another for centos)
Change-Id: Ic40122a084624ff9c5eafa9f372b0451e857e29a
Signed-off-by: Peter Mikus <pmikus@cisco.com>
|
|
Change-Id: Ibab23153b698470e640530c44d95ca6f3c4898b2
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Add download and install script for rpms.
Add topology virl file for Centos.
Change VPP repo urls for centos.
JIRA: CSIT-356
Change-Id: I3a0a88958a712d1b652f19c76e5e1b019796d0ae
Signed-off-by: Thomas F Herbert <therbert@redhat.com>
|
|
Change-Id: I2e495f99a88dedc47f64efcc14722bb629a25f02
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: I7cefd0797103e5062eb48df95ad2e48cdddc19b6
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- change of ts directories
- change of ts file names
- splitting of former files to more files when suitable
- more details:
https://wiki.fd.io/view/CSIT/csit-perf-tc-naming-change
Change-Id: Ifda1038f8323735f86c1be7ba7f93e3fda183618
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use new vpp ref build: 17.04-rc0~134-g2ce7f98~b1759_amd64
- build tested by semiweekly job:
https://jenkins.fd.io/job/csit-vpp-verify-master-semiweekly/1076/
- use new path for DPDK packages
Change-Id: I1001ee3a22817f97a60b3a6555e3026d2b153913
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Add cmake into VIRL Ubuntu image
Change-Id: I2cd33a58c0043a2c3e04809d1f73068520767929
Signed-off-by: pmikus <pmikus@cisco.com>
|
|
Change-Id: Icf9f37e0ab0ce4eef3532d3b18f82e9dc5f8f999
Signed-off-by: Tibor Frank <tifrank@cisco.com>
|
|
- Add libpcap-dev packages to VIRL image
- Small fixes
Change-Id: I111b0d7e89180ffb7efa76c6503e687f715367f8
Signed-off-by: pmikus <pmikus@cisco.com>
|
|
- Update the repository to get xenial packages
- Update phy topology files with new pass
- Update bootstrap to use new VIRL image
- Update framework to reflect 16.04 dependencies
- CSIT-116: Modify VIRL username/password
Change-Id: I4de44755170fd0481acef34c7c2d9c299bc300da
Signed-off-by: pmikus <pmikus@cisco.com>
|
|
- Ubuntu 14.04.4
- Includes all changes in 1.1 and 1.2 (Java 8, Docker, Bridge utils)
- Add StrongSwan package
Change-Id: Iedf7e701e79062de0cd2d11d8d2e78c132d239fc
Signed-off-by: pmikus <pmikus@cisco.com>
|
|
- add library for SPAN setup
- add telemetry traffic script and a keyword to run it
- add "telemetry" folders for python and robot libraries
- move IPFIX libraries to these new folders
- add first SPAN test case, mirroring IPv4 ICMP packets
Change-Id: Ibca35f724c13662bf80dce2d7e2649d1a0b8676a
Signed-off-by: selias <samelias@cisco.com>
|
|
- store log files in tmp directory and exclude all files in this
directory from archiving when creating tarballs
Change-Id: Ie3e11670c9d466c5fcf41d03ccd0a7bbb04ffeb0
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use parallel test set runs on as many VIRL sessions as needed
for defined test sets
Change-Id: I7640f15894a1451aba963989fab4dc838f2ab6d8
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use integrity and/or encryption key(s) different from
integrity and encryption keys stored on VPP node to create
tx packet on TG
Change-Id: I38bf7e1dd6f488e605bad991c7a7f4d1ff226e8c
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use new vpp ref build: 16.12-rc0~30-g35f9daa~b1052_amd64
- build tested by semiweekly job:
https://jenkins.fd.io/job/csit-vpp-verify-master-semiweekly/1031/
Change-Id: I858e483498de017610de30c984d49a7c78a92649
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use all supported encryption and integrity algorithms in tunnel mode
and in transport mode
Change-Id: I2ae395d88d514b2ca3f62ab9aecbb27d8fb827b0
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Change-Id: I3d8fd7454c7629dbe048470ebb17dbc0c542f1af
Signed-off-by: Matej Klotton <mklotton@cisco.com>
|
|
- Move performance directory one level up and rename it to “perf”
- Rename “suites” directory to “func”
- Create __init__.py in “perf” directory
- Rename fds_related_tests to fds
Change-Id: I59f06afe1c5b95dd8a48417b8fbfd1fca8797097
Signed-off-by: Matej Klotton <mklotton@cisco.com>
|
|
Change-Id: Iaa914280f7193a10072735fbcd67fcd668d3a12e
Signed-off-by: Miroslav Miklus <mmiklus@cisco.com>
|
|
- add tag SKIP_PATCH to FDS related tests and exclude them from
execution in case of vpp-csit-verify and csit-vpp-verify jobs
Change-Id: I14237a78529b3d3c9b586041a24ceef303c1394b
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- use the same file names VPP_REPO_URL and VPP_STABLE_VER acrross
branches to store the current branch repo url and stable vpp
build version
Change-Id: Ie7c020d5b3722bfe3eb34a374b98a29cc76676f2
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- add VPP_REPO_URL file to store path to VPP build repository
- add VPP_STABLE_VER file to store VPP stable build version
- adapt bootstrap*.sh files to read VPP build repository path
and VPP stable build version from files
Change-Id: I2997320ec3df68eaf092795e5d553fb3f024d366
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
- update vpp build to version 16.09-rc0~47-g3419d0b~b214_amd64
in bootstrap.sh and bootstrap-vpp-verify-weekly.sh
- remove tag EXPECTED_FAILING from VXLAN over IPv6 test cases as
the VPP-98 is closed
Change-Id: I377f7ee931424e6d38e918aeb9fc7ab450875631
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Allow VirtualEnv to use existing system-wide packages if they already exist.
Change-Id: I6f39178d56e81affea0bee7b9065bef66712ddaa
Signed-off-by: Carsten Koester <ckoester@cisco.com>
|
|
- test cases to test MAC split-horizon group functionality together
with VXLAN tunnel over IPv4 and over IPv6
- two IPv6 tests tagged EXPECTED_FAILING until VPP-98 is closed
- added update of bootstrap.sh - vpp build updated to version
16.09-rc0~33-g4b46c84~b200_amd64
Change-Id: I1da6a98b11f5c39cd114abb35bb8f398cbbebf63
Signed-off-by: Jan Gelety <jgelety@cisco.com>
|
|
Add a mechanism to the bootstrap script that allows it to select
one out of multiple candidate VIRL hosts. In addition, fix a few
cosmetic issues wrt. connecting to the VIRL host:
* Use consistent set of SSH options
* Consistently use constant instead of hardcoded key filename
* Use relative path names for start-/stop-testcase scripts
Change-Id: I0d2972f170de82dd5d98da88656f5f962fca2415
Signed-off-by: Carsten Koester <ckoester@cisco.com>
|
|
Change-Id: I91ccd65a26ea1782611bccc3badd91e64366a162
Signed-off-by: Matej Klotton <mklotton@cisco.com>
|